Die Erfindung bezweckt nun eine selbsttätige Anpassung der Ketterispannung an die jeweilige Umlaufzahl des Explosionsmotors.As is well known, the tension of the drive chains of the control shafts is allowed of explosion engines should not be too large if impermissible stresses are avoided should be. The most favorable chain tension at lower circulating speeds However, the increase in circulation and the correspondingly increasing centrifugal forces the chain as insufficient. The invention now aims at an automatic adaptation the chain tension to the respective number of revolutions of the explosion engine.

Gemäß ,der Erfindung ist die Kettenspannrolle an einem beweglichen, unter Einfluß des Schmieröldruckes des Motors stehenden Glied gelagert.According to the invention, the chain idler is on a movable, stored member standing under the influence of the lubricating oil pressure of the engine.

B. zwecks Demontage ganz entspannen zu können.The chain idler i for the chain 2 is one in the forked end 3 Piston 4 mounted, which is inserted in a cylinder 5 so as to be longitudinally displaceable. Around the cylinder 5 is arranged a coil spring 6, which is below the cylinder base forming wall of the motor housing is supported and above on a bead of the piston 4 attacks and the role i with a voribesti, mmten initial tension on the chain 2 .presses. The cylinder 5 is connected to the lubricating oil pressure line via a check valve 7 8 in connection. The piston 4 has a continuous channel, which with an adjustable pressure relief valve is provided. The mouth of this canal g is directed against the bearing of the tension roller 2, so that in the event of an impermissibly high oil pressure through the appropriately set valve io, oil escaping against the bearing i i this tension pulley splashes and. serves for lubrication. At the pressure chamber of the cylinder can still be a relief valve attached to the chain 6 z. B. for the purpose of dismantling to be able to relax completely.

Aufbiegung bewegtes Glied mit der Spannrolle in Verbindung steht.To regulate the tension of the chain could instead be in a pressure cylinder displaceable piston also another device, e.g. B. one through membranes. closed expansion box or a curved pipe, the interior of which can be used with the lubricant pressure line and its member moved by stretching or bending is in connection with the tensioner pulley.
